Detailed Description
The Xiaomi Smart Band 8 Pendant is a sleek and versatile wearable device designed for daily use. It features a 1.62-inch AMOLED touch display that provides vibrant visuals. With up to 600 nits of brightness, visibility is excellent under various lighting conditions.
Crafted with a 2.5D reinforced glass case, the Xiaomi Smart Band 8 Pendant possesses a premium feel and durability. The adjustable band fits comfortably between 135mm and 210mm.
Key Features:
- Dimensions: 48mm width, 22.5mm height, 10.99mm thickness, weight approximately 27 grams.
- Display: 192 x 490 pixels resolution, 326 ppi density, 60Hz refresh rate.
- Sensors: Includes a 6-axis sensor and a PPG heart rate sensor.
- Battery: Powered by a 190mAh battery, lasting over 16 days on typical use.
Additionally, the band is water-resistant up to 5ATM, making it suitable for swimming and other water activities. It supports Bluetooth 5.1 BLE for seamless connectivity and is compatible with smartphones running Android 6.0 or later and iOS 12.0 or later.
With over 150 fitness modes, it supports heart rate monitoring, SpO2 tracking, and sleep monitoring. Users can customize their watch faces with over 200 options, enhancing their experience.
